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Se Permiten Mascotas en Treasure Island

Cuál es el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más barato en Treasure Island?

Actualmente el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más accequible en Treasure Island está en The Drake at St. Pete listado en $1,268.

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en Treasure Island?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en Treasure Island es $1,906.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as más grande en Treasure Island?

A día de hoy el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as con más metros cuadrados en Treasure Island una unidad de 1,469 a partir de $1,660 en The Courtney at Bay Pines.
